Why use a Wormery?

Wormeries are incredibly simple and natural waste converters that take cooked and uncooked food waste, shredded newspaper, cardboard, tea bags and egg cartons (or other similar items) and divert them away from the bin. In the UK we usually send nearly 7 million tonnes of food waste or peelings to landfill! So do your bit to cut the total down the interesting way.

Produce your own compost with the Midi Wormery

Using the Midi Wormery is an almost odourless process as the worms eat the waste right away rather than letting it decompose. If you do smell something from your wormery it is most likely to be a healthy composty smell that is a sign you are on your way to making a beautiful compost and a liquid feed (sometimes referred to as 'Black Gold'). It takes only a couple of weeks to compost a whole handful of waste and over a year you can fill and harvest one whole bin of nutritious compost. The liquid feed that settles at the bottom of the Midi Wormery can be collected on average every 3 or 4 weeks.

The design:

The self-contained Wormeries feature a unique patented internal draining system which works to create a pit of liquid feed towards the bottom of the chamber which is easily collectable via a tap. Worms are 'surface-feeders' so they will always work their way to the top of the bin leaving their worm compost settled beneath them.
